Abstract
The current status of international microgrid research, development, and demonstration (RD&D) was on display and open for review and debate in Tianjin, China, 13?14 ?November 2014 at the Tianjin 2014 Symposium on Microgrids. Sponsored by the U.S. Department of Energy Office of Electricity Delivery and Energy Reliability (U.S. DOE-OE) and the Energy Foundation, organized by Tianjin University, Hefei University of Technology, and supported by other generous sponsors, the tenth in the influential series of microgrid symposiums was held at the Geneva Grand Hotel. Broad international participation was achieved, with 106 attendees from 18 countries (Figure 1). There were 26 technical presentations by speakers from around the globe as well as a panel session on standards development and technical tours to the Tianjin ?Eco-City sustainable city development, Tianjin University?s Microgrid Laboratory, and the Yanqing dc microgrid near Beijing. The formal welcome was offered by Zhipeng Liang, deputy director of the ?Renewable Energy Department, Chinese National Energy Administration.
